This is the Comfortable Workbook for “Dante’s Divine Comedy as Told for Young People” by Joseph Tusiani. The Comfortable Workbook is printed in a dyslexia-friendly font. The layout is more spacious than the regular workbooks so that there is less on each page. The Comfortable workbook includes comprehension questions with multiple choice answers. It also includes discussion/essay questions. Character & place indexing at the back includes cut-and-paste character descriptions that can be glued onto the indexing page so that students do not have to write words in order to do the work. SneakerBlossom Study Guides are available in six print and two digital versions. Answer Key, available in print and digital versions, includes comprehension and discussion/essay questions and answers. Complete Study Guide includes comprehension and discussion/essay questions in the front for the student, and questions and answers in the back for the teacher. It is print only. Relaxed Workbook (comprehension questions with multiple-choice and fill-in-the-blank answers) Studious Workbook (comprehension questions with lines for the student’s answers) Scholarly Workbook (comprehension and discussion/essay questions, with lines for the student’s answers under the comprehension questions) Comfortable Workbook (dyslexia-friendly font, comprehension questions with multiple choice answers, discussion/essay questions, and cut-and-paste character indexing) Questions Only digital version of the Study Guide includes all comprehension and discussion/essay questions. A supplementary art guide, the “SneakerBlossom Art Guide for Dante’s Divine Comedy and Dante’s Divine Comedy as Told for Young People”, is available and includes color pictures of art whose subject matter is Dante’s “Divine Comedy” along with discussion questions. All SneakerBlossom Medieval History Study Guides include character and place indexing and a glossary for difficult vocabulary words. Print versions also include map work.
